/ / Pastie avec API et détection de langue - api, mise en évidence de la syntaxe, pastie

Pastie avec API et détection de langue - api, mise en évidence de la syntaxe, pastie

J'essaie de trouver un type de service Web qui effectue une sorte d'automatique détection du langage (en terme de langage de programmation) et colore la syntaxe en conséquence.

La plupart des sites Web de pastie n’ont pas cette fonctionnalité que j’aimerais vraiment avoir et utiliser.

Merci !

Réponses:

0 pour la réponse № 1

Pygments a quelque chose de proche: http://pygments.org/docs/quickstart/#lexer-and-formatter-lookup

>>> from pygments.lexers import guess_lexer, guess_lexer_for_filename

>>> guess_lexer("#!/usr/bin/pythonnprint "Hello World!"")
<pygments.lexers.PythonLexer>

Pas parfait mais déjà très utile.

Mais oui je partage votre frustration avec le service de pâte, avait la même chose. A mon avis, la coloration devrait être faite côté client.

https://github.com/alexgorbatchev/SyntaxHighlighter http://code.google.com/p/google-code-prettify/

sont très gentils à cet égard.


0 pour la réponse № 2

J'ai fini de développer mon propre outil pour le faire. Il s'appelle UU et effectue une reconnaissance automatique de la syntaxe à l'aide de highlight.js.

  • http://uu.zoy.org est gratuit et encodez localement ce que vous collez dans votre navigateur avant de l’envoyer au serveur.
  • L'API est WIP.